Css

当你使用命名的颜色时,你在应用不同颜色的深浅方面有点受限制。 红色、绿色、蓝色、黄色或任何其他命名的颜色都有很多变化,你无法使用命名的颜色。 你只能使用浏览器认可的大约 147 种预定义颜色。 它是在 CSS 中为文本(以及其他任何需要颜色的东西)指定颜色的另一种方式。 顾名思义,你使用了 colour 属性,并通过命名你想要的颜色来应用这个值。 这可能是红色、绿色、蓝色、橙色、深红色、青色,或任何其他命名的颜色。

css

Docusaurus 是一款基于 React 框架构建的易于维护的静态网站创建工具。 Docusaurus 能够帮你快速建立文档网站、博客、营销页面等。 H2 这样显示与内容就分开了(由于CSS的优点,W3C现在正在考虑将HTML中的许多显示用的指令废弃掉)。 HTML只表达文章的结构,CSS表达所有的显示。

所以尽管这一标准的支持度还不完善,仍建议优先使用该方法。 推荐大家阅读下奇舞周刊之前推的《嗨,送你一张Web性能优化地图》1这篇文章,能够帮助大家对性能优化需要做的事以及需要考虑的问题形成一个整体的概念。 其中,max 属性描述这个 progress 元素所表示的任务一共需要完成多少工作量,value 属性用来指定该进度条已完成的工作量。 从内部实现上看,Tailwind 依赖于 PostCSS 的 AST 进行修改,而 Windi 则是编写了一个自定义解析器和 AST。 考虑到在开发过程中,这些工具 CSS 的并不经常变化,UnoCSS 通过非常高效的字符串拼接来直接生成对应的 CSS 而非引入整个编译过程。 同时,UnoCSS 对类名和生成的 CSS 字符串进行了缓存,当再次遇到相同的实用工具类时,它可以绕过整个匹配和生成的过程。

css

本书从装帧、版式设计开始就已经比很多设计类书籍都要精致好看了。 更不可思议的是整本书都是作者用SCSS写成的,无法想像的工作量以及这么精美的排版是怎么做到的。 本书所传达的DRY思想贯穿始终,对于CSS的设计提供了非常有用的思路。

css

现在是时候研究“如何相对于可视区域将你的盒子彼此间放置于正确位置”了。 样式化文本 在学习了 CSS 语言基础知识的基础上,你需要关注的下一个重点是样式化文本——这是使用 CSS 时最常用的场景之一。 在这一模块将学习文本样式设置的基础知识,包括设置字体、粗体、斜体、行、字符间距、阴影以及其他文本属性。 我们通过在页面上应用自定义的字体以及样式化的列表、链接来完善本模块。 大多数朋友应该都知道CSS选择器的匹配是从右向左进行的,这一策略导致了不同种类的选择器之间的性能也存在差异。 相比于#markdown-content-h3,显然使用#markdown .content material h3时,浏览器生成渲染树(render-tree)所要花费的时间更多。

css

不过我们仍需要避免不必要的重绘,如页面滚动时触发的hover事件,可以在滚动的时候禁用hover事件,这样页面在滚动时会更加流畅。 当然,并不是让大家不要使用这些属性,因为这些应该都是我们经常使用的属性。 当有两种方案可以选择的时候,可以优先选择没有昂贵属性或昂贵属性更少的方案,如果每次都这样的选择,网站的性能会在不知不觉中得到一定的提升。 使用统一的方法论能够帮助大家形成统一的风格,减少命名冲突,也能避免上述的问题,总之好处多多,如果你还没有使用,就赶快用起来吧。 与第二种方式相似,我们还可以通过rel属性将link元素标记为alternate可选样式表,也能实现浏览器异步加载。 CSS会阻塞渲染,在CSS文件请求、下载、解析完成之前,浏览器将不会渲染任何已处理的内容。

css

在本教程中,您将在安装了 NetBeans Connector 扩展的 Chrome 浏览器中运行应用程序。 安装扩展之后,您可以在浏览器中使用 NetBeans 菜单以方便地调整浏览器窗口大小,用于查看应用程序在一些常用设备上的显示。 在本教程中,您将使用站点模板来创建 HTML5 项目。 您在此教程中使用的站点模板是您在 HTML5 应用程序入门教程中保存的同一个站点模板。 如果您执行了入门教程中的步骤,则可以使用上一部分中保存的站点模板。 此外,您可以下载 HTML5DemoSiteTemplate.zip 站点模板。

  • 通过组合选择器,可以更加精确地处理希望赋予某种表示的元素。
  • 总之,CSS样式表可以将所有的样式声明统一存放,进行统一管理。
  • CSS可以零散地直接添加在要应用样式的网页元素上,也可以集中化内置于网页、链接式引入网页以及导入式引入网页。
  • 压缩CSS使得体积减小,传输速度快,格式化CSS在线转换成易编写、易读。
  • 从内部实现上看,Tailwind 依赖于 PostCSS 的 AST 进行修改,而 Windi 则是编写了一个自定义解析器和 AST。